Dr Brauer and Associates is a modern, multi-faceted general medical practice with a special interest in occupational health and travel medicine.
For travellers we have a fully licensed travel clinic where we can provide all recommended travel vaccinations such as Yellow Fever, Hepatitis A, Typhoid, Rabies, Meningitis and more as well as equipping our clients with the most appropriate malaria protection. Our occupational health practice focuses on general occupational medicals with local and international companies, including working at heights, professional drivers, divers and offshore workers. We are approved to perform Diving medicals, SAMSA, OGUK and Norwegian Maritime Authority medicals. We are also the only approved facility in Cape Town to perform US immigration medicals.
Our general medical practice serves residents and visitors to Cape Town alike for any general health related matters, and we are able to perform blood testing, ECG’s, hearing and lung function tests. A pharmacy is located within the same building, which makes our practice convenient to visit with parking I the basement of the Clock Tower building (P2 & P3 underground parking at the Silo District).
Our practice is open and offers all services from 08H00 until 16H30 during weekdays.
On Saturdays only the Travel Clinic is open from 09H00 – 13H00.
We are closed on Sundays and public holidays. As we prefer to work on a booked appointment basis, we recommend that bookings are arranged telephonically on 021 419 1888.

Emily is a Youth Empowerment Expert with over 20 years’ experience in the space. Emily co-founded Amathuba Collective, offering extensive programmes to strengthen young people’s emotional and mental wellbeing.
Their passion to help youth to love themselves and grow into positive and confident humans has informed the V&A Academy approach. At the Academy she guides and oversees activities from an impact perspective to ensure we achieve measurable, lasting change in the young people and their hosting businesses.
Thabile in a seasoned HR Practitioner with a special focus on youth employment. She leads young teams and develops talent in administrative and compliance roles.
At the Academy she liaises with hosts, managers and supervisors to support the development of the young people and their ability to add significant value to their employers. She guides the administrative processes to ensure smooth and impactful implementation the Academy’s projects.
Brett leads the V&A Academy team and is responsible for strategic partnerships to create job opportunities for young people across the V&A Waterfront.
He focuses on enabling career paths for under-resourced youth in Cape Town’s tourism, retail, and hospitality sectors. Brett is passionate about supporting young people’s transition into the workplace and ensuring host businesses nurture their growth. He works to help businesses improve customer service excellence by developing young talent. Brett oversees the design and delivery of training programs, collaborating with employers, funders, and partners to create lasting, positive change across the V&A Waterfront ecosystem.
